Backend Software Engineer (EAA)

📍 World
USD 128,800-151,500 per year
MIDDLE
✅ Remote

SCRAPED

Used Tools & Technologies

Not specified

Required Skills & Competences ?

Security @ 3 Go @ 5 Kafka @ 3 Kubernetes @ 2 Ruby @ 3 Terraform @ 2 Python @ 3 SQL @ 3 ETL @ 3 NoSQL @ 3 AWS @ 2 gRPC @ 3 JavaScript @ 3 React @ 3 Debugging @ 3 API @ 3 GraphQL @ 3 ChatGPT @ 3 Compliance @ 3

Details

At Coinbase, our mission is to increase economic freedom in the world through building an emerging onchain platform and the future global financial system.

Team

The Agent Productivity Tools (APT) team is part of Coinbase’s Enterprise Applications and Architecture org, focused on building customer experience platforms that streamline customer service and compliance processes using innovative services, tools, and applications, improving customer satisfaction and compliance.

Role

You will build applications enabling Coinbase Customer Agents and other users to improve productivity, drive automation, and deliver scale impact through AI/ML technologies.

Responsibilities

  • Build complete user features including front and backend with React, JS frameworks, Golang, and cloud technologies.
  • Lead assessment and implementation of third-party AI/ML tools.
  • Collaborate cross-functionally with product, design, security, data, and engineering teams to solve complex problems.
  • Enhance Coinbase's platform and development practices.
  • Innovate and transform ideas into action.
  • Anticipate issues and adapt to avoid adverse impacts.
  • Communicate complex technical topics to both technical and non-technical audiences.
  • Mentor team members on design, coding, testing, deployment, documentation, metrics, and scaling.
  • Work with global teams across multiple time zones.

Requirements

  • Minimum 2 years software engineering experience.
  • At least 2 years developing large-scale systems with Golang and cloud technologies.
  • Experience shipping user-facing features with JavaScript and component-based frameworks like React.
  • Proven integration of AI/ML APIs into web applications.
  • Experience with third-party vendor integrations.
  • Knowledge of large-scale, high-traffic platforms and scalable service implementations.
  • Experience contributing to technical architecture.
  • Familiarity with AWS, Kubernetes, Terraform, BuildKite or similar tools.
  • Knowledge of rate limiters, caching, load balancing, circuit breakers, metrics, logging, tracing, debugging.
  • Experience with event-driven architectures (Kafka, MQ), SQL or NoSQL databases, gRPC, GraphQL, ETL concepts.
  • Proficiency in Go.

Nice to Haves

  • Python, Ruby.
  • SaaS platform experience.
  • Applications using OpenAI/ChatGPT.

Benefits

  • Medical, Dental, Vision plans with generous contributions.
  • Health Savings Account with company contributions.
  • Disability and Life Insurance.
  • 401(k) plan with company match.
  • Wellness, Mobile/Internet, and Connections Stipends.
  • Volunteer time off.
  • Fertility counseling and benefits.
  • Generous leave policy.
  • Option to receive payment in digital currency.